Plant Vogtle Unit 4 Begins Commercial Operation, No More New Nuclear Under Construction

Georgia Energy announced this week that the 1,114-megawatt (MW) Unit 4 nuclear energy reactor at Plant Vogtle close to Waynesboro, Georgia, entered into business operation after connecting to the ability grid in March 2024. The business begin of Unit 4 completes the 11-year growth challenge at Plant Vogtle. No nuclear reactors are below building now in the USA.

Vogtle Unit 3 started business operation in July 2023. The plant’s first two reactors, with a mixed 2,430 MW of nameplate capacitystarted operations in 1987 and 1989. The 2 new reactors convey Plant Vogtle’s complete producing capability to just about 5 gigawatts (GW), surpassing the 4,210-MW Palo Verde plant in Arizona and making Vogtle’s 4 items the biggest nuclear energy plant in the USA.

Building on the two new reactor websites began in 2009. Initially anticipated to value $14 billion and start business operation in 2016 (Vogtle 3) and in 2017 (Vogtle 4), the challenge bumped into important building delays and price overruns. Georgia Energy now estimates the entire value of the challenge to be more than $30 billion.

The business working date is when builders hand over a reactor to the plant proprietor or operator, declaring the reactor to be formally in business operation.

With a complete put in capacity of about 97 GW, the biggest business nuclear producing fleet of any nation is positioned in the USA. The fleet of working nuclear energy reactors accounted for practically 19% of home electrical energy manufacturing in 2023, making nuclear the second-largest supply of U.S. electrical energy technology after pure gasoline, which accounted for 43% of electrical energy technology in the USA final 12 months.

Electrical energy technology from nuclear reactors doesn’t produce CO2 emissions and might present baseload energy that may in any other case largely come from coal- and pure gas-fired vegetation. Though quite a lot of nuclear reactors have retired in recent times, interest in nuclear energy as an vitality useful resource to assist scale back the carbon footprint of the U.S. electrical energy sector has elevated just lately.

Each Vogtle Items 3 and 4 use a more recent reactor design, the Westinghouse AP1000. This reactor has a smaller footprint and less complicated design than earlier technology reactor applied sciences. It additionally options passive security methods which can be meant to close down the reactor with none operator motion or exterior energy supply.

Vogtle Items 3 and 4 are the primary and solely U.S. deployments of the AP1000 Era III+ reactor. Two different Westinghouse AP1000 reactors have been deliberate for a nuclear energy plant in South Carolina, however utilities there halted building in 2017.
